Cabochon Definition. Historically, a cabochon — also referred to as a cab — is a gemstone that has been shaped and polished instead of faceted. These stones typically have a flat side and one domed side. Nowadays, cabochons are made of more than just gemstones. You can find ceramic, porcelain and even wooden ones.

Grinding. Grinding, usually with silicon carbide wheels or diamond-impregnated wheels, is used to shape gemstones to a desired rough form, called a preform.As with sawing, a coolant/lubricant (water or oil) is used to remove debris and prevent overheating. Very coarse diamond or silicon carbide, such as 60 grit, or mesh, (400 micron particles) or 100 grit (150 micron particles) is used for ...
Lapidary (from the Latin lapidarius) is the practice of shaping stone, minerals, or gemstones into decorative items such as cabochons, engraved gems (including cameos), and faceted designs. A person who practices lapidary is known as a lapidarist.A lapidarist uses the lapidary techniques of cutting, grinding, and polishing. Hardstone carving requires specialized carving techniques.

For faceted cuts the grindstone is flat surfaced; for cabochon cuts, it is grooved. While grinding, some lapidaries hold the gem in their fingers; others use a lapidary's stick, or dop, to which the gem is cemented. They polish the gems by holding them against a canvas-covered wheel impregnated with ferric oxide, or jeweler's rouge.
Cutting a cabochon involves cutting and polishing a semi precious gem stone into a polished piece of rock with one flat side and one domed side. It is a fairly simple process once you know what you are doing, but it does take quite a bit of practice to perfect.

The grinding operation is complete when the stone is fully shaped. The next step is sanding with a 220 grit carbide belt on a water cooled sander with expandable rubber drums. The 220 grit belt is used to remove the scratches left in the surface of the cab by the 100 grit diamond wheel. The 220 grit belt is also abrasive enough that it can be ...
